Output 80f868efc83d9997cdd045f5df857e61d89cf85f7e16804c3388d6771314c690:2

value
4015993
script pubkey
OP_0 OP_PUSHBYTES_20 58d696dabea15862863b1c7ed1afd6a61f6de373
address
ltc1qtrtfdk4759vx9p3mr3ldrt7k5c0kmcmn9xrhta
transaction
80f868efc83d9997cdd045f5df857e61d89cf85f7e16804c3388d6771314c690
spent
true